[QUOTE="liftingheavy220, post: 109903, member: 16484"] Hey everyone, I’ve been on TRT since August 2017 until April 2018, I’m only 25 and would really like to try and get my T levels back up so I don’t need to inject. After my last injection of testosterone cypionate (April 28th) I waited two weeks before starting clomid. I used clomid for 4 weeks starting with 150mg, 100mg, 50mg and then 50mg for the last week. I decided to seek out a renowned HRT doctor and this is the protocol he prescribed: HCG at 1500iu eod with arimidex twice a week. My Dr wants me to be on this protocol for 6 weeks. He explained that after about 6 weeks my T levels should be back to normal. Will using 1500ius of HCG eod for 6 weeks cause desensitized leydig cells? Is there potential for irreversible endocrine damage? Any advice or comments would be appreciated [/QUOTE]
